Interest Expense
The cost incurred by an entity for borrowed funds, typically reported on the income statement.
Coupon Interest Rate
The annual interest rate paid on a bond, expressed as a percentage of the face value and paid from issue date until maturity.
Market Rate
The current interest rate available in the marketplace for similar financial instruments or loans.
Discount
A reduction applied to the regular price of goods or services, or the amount by which a bond sells below its par value.
